The top of Tilberthwaite Gill (up on High Topps, below Wetherlam) is very Swallowdale/Golden Gulch - like. More Swallowdale-like because of the stream and the little waterfalls, but then of course PP is during a major drought when the streams and springs are all dry. It is easy to find because the footpath goes right through it - I think there's a little bridge. There's a cave there - perfectly serviceable as Peter Duck's or as the mine. It doesn't feel quite secret enough for Swallowdale - I don't think you could imagine stumbling into it and thinking "what a perfect place for a camp".
